Two glass containers M and N are joined by a valve that is closed. M contains helium at $20\,^{\circ}\text{C}$ under a pressure of $1 \times 10^5\,\text{Pa}$. N is evacuated and has a volume three times that of M. In an experiment, the valve is opened and the temperature of the entire apparatus is increased to $100\,^{\circ}\text{C}$. What is the final pressure in the system?
- A$3.18 \times 10^4\,\text{Pa}$
- B$4.24 \times 10^4\,\text{Pa}$
- C$1.25 \times 10^5\,\text{Pa}$
- D$5.09 \times 10^5\,\text{Pa}$
